How much do remote solutions eng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 2, 2026, the average yearly pay for remote solutions engineer in Maine is $119,363.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$98,300.00 and $136,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a remote solutions engineer?

A Remote Solutions Engineer is a technical professional who helps customers understand, implement, and optimize a company's products or services, typically in a pre-sales or post-sales capacity. They work remotely to assess client needs, provide technical demonstrations, troubleshoot issues, and collaborate with sales and engineering teams. Their role often requires a mix of technical expertise, communication skills, and problem-solving abilities to ensure customer success.

What are the primary responsibilities of a remote solutions engineer on a daily basis?

A Remote Solutions Engineer typically spends their days designing technical solutions, troubleshooting client issues, and collaborating with both internal teams and clients via video calls, chat, or emails. Responsibilities often include gathering requirements, developing and implementing architectures, supporting technical pre-sales processes, and providing ongoing support and optimization for deployed solutions. Because the role is remote, strong self-management and proactive communication are essential, and most interaction happens in a virtual team environment. This allows for flexibility, but also requires a high degree of autonomy and accountability to ensure project milestones and customer satisfaction are consistently achieved.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the remote solutions engineer position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Solutions Engineer, you need strong technical expertise in IT systems, software development, and solutions architecture, typically backed by a degree in computer science or a related field. Experience with cloud platforms (like A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ud), networking tools, and relevant certifications such as AWS Certified Solutions Architect or CompTIA Network+ are highly valued. Exceptional communication, problem-solving skills, and the ability to manage projects independently are crucial soft skills for this remote role. These competencies ensure you can effectively design, implement, and support tailored solutions for clients while collaborating with distributed teams and meeting business objectives.
